Low Vf Schottky for 2 A rail rectification

The STPS2L40UF is a 40 V, 2 A Schottky barrier rectifier from STMicroelectronics in the low-profile SMBflat package. Its forward voltage of 430 mV at the full 2 A rating keeps conduction loss low in output rectification and freewheeling stages.

At 2 A forward current the typical Vf is 430 mV. Reverse leakage at 40 V is 220 µA.

Package and footprint — SMBflat land pattern

The SMBflat package is a surface-mount body with flat leads that sit flush with the PCB pad. The land pattern differs from a standard SMB.
